What this role involves
Capital Rx seeks a Senior Platform Developer to architect and maintain scalable infrastructure and CI/CD pipelines. The role requires expertise in cloud services (AWS), automation tools like Terraform, and databases such as PostgreSQL and Redis. Compliance with HIPAA and other standards is a key responsibility.
